Tragic Arson in Richmond Hill: Two Arrested After Fire Claims Lives of 11-Year-Old Girl and Aunt
Two arrested in fatal Richmond Hill arson case

York Regional Police have made a significant breakthrough in a heartbreaking case that has shaken the Richmond Hill community. Two individuals now face serious charges following a deliberately set fire that claimed the lives of an 11-year-old girl and her aunt.

Community in Mourning After Tragic Loss

The devastating blaze erupted in the early hours of the morning at a residential home, sending flames tearing through the structure while residents slept. Despite the courageous efforts of firefighters who battled the inferno, the young girl and her aunt could not be saved from the rapidly spreading fire.

Emergency crews responded to multiple 911 calls reporting the fire, with witnesses describing scenes of chaos and terror as neighbors watched helplessly while the home became engulfed in flames.

Breakthrough in Investigation

After an intensive investigation spanning several days, York Regional Police's Homicide Unit and the Ontario Fire Marshal's office determined the fire was deliberately set. The evidence pointed toward arson, leading to the identification and arrest of two suspects.

The accused now face serious charges including:

  • Arson causing bodily harm
  • Criminal negligence causing death
  • Additional related offenses
